Hallucination -- the briefing is about 2 hours, maybe a little less.... I am probably in the minority, but I appreciate the thoroughness with the boat briefing. They go over all the systems on the boat in great detail, at the end you will know not only where all the switches are but also how each system works and, if there is a problem, where to find the source of it and maybe even how to fix it. For me, much easier to get on with vacation if I can just quickly fix any small problem that may pop up versus calling for outside assistance.
Having said that, the biggest problem we have ever had on one of the IYC Island Packets was a shower drain that started draining slow, but, since they showed me where the strainers were during the briefing, I took care of the problem in a couple of minutes myself.
